Responsive HTML Skin (Azure) does not generate edited fields in the output. RoboHelp 2020

  • June 30, 2021
  • 5 replies
  • 390 views

I have edited the Azure_Blue skin to my company branding (colour scheme, font, etc), and changed the Home logo in the Header bar. In the skin editor, everything shows as desired, however, when generating the output to Responsive HTML, the skin displays the default template, showing none of my changes.

    This topic has been closed for replies.
    Correct answer Jeff_Coatsworth

    Did you select the customized version in the Output Preset?

    Hi Jeff,
    It is sorted now... The Responsive HTML > Layout parameter for 'Skin' was not pointing to the skin I edited... Thank you for your time, it is much appreciated.
